Abstract

The utility model discloses a parking system of an automobile gearbox. The parking system comprises a cam (7a), a pawl return spring (8a), a parking pawl (9a) and a parking ratchet wheel (12a), wherein the cam can axially move, and is pressed on the upper surface of the extension part of the pawl return spring; the pawl return spring is arranged above the front end of the parking pawl, and the lower surface of the extension part of the pawl return spring is pressed on the parking pawl; the parking pawl is rotatably arranged on a gearbox body, the front end of the parking pawl is provided with a downward-extended boss (9a1); the external circumference of the parking ratchet wheel is provided with a limit slot (12a1) matched with the boss on the parking pawl; the cam can be used for axially driving the pawl return spring to move up and down; the pawl return spring can drive the parking pawl to move up and down, so that the boss is parked in or exits from the limit slot of the parking ratchet wheel; the parking ratchet wheel is arranged on a differential shell; the parking system can be used for solving the problem that parking failure is easily caused when the parking ratchet wheel is arranged on an input shaft.

Background technique
Existing a kind of automotive transmission parking system, as shown in Figure 1, comprises motor 1, worm screw 2, worm gear 3, gear 4, tooth bar 5, spring 6, cam 7, parking return spring 8, park pawl 9 and parking ratchet wheel 10; Described parking ratchet wheel 10 is enclosed within on input shaft, is connected with input shaft interference swelling, and input shaft is directly connected with motor.When needing parking, park pawl 9 moves downward in the dovetail groove that snaps in parking ratchet wheel 10, and parking ratchet wheel 10 is no longer rotated.This automotive transmission parking system, under the severe condition of operating mode, stressed when excessive when parking ratchet wheel 10, easily cause parking ratchet wheel 10 to trackslip on input shaft, thereby cause park pawl 9 and parking ratchet wheel 10 to get loose, parking was lost efficacy.In the time that this automotive transmission parking system is used for many gears pure electric automobile speed changer, if parking ratchet wheel 10 is arranged on input shaft, while needing parking, speed changer must be hung into effectively parking of gear.If hung for a long time into gear parking, will shorten greatly working life.

embodiment
Below in conjunction with the drawings and specific embodiments, the utility model is described in further detail.
Shown in Figure 2, automotive transmission parking system of the present utility model, comprises motor 1a, worm screw 2a, worm gear 3a, gear 4a, tooth bar 5a, spring 6a, cam 7a, ratchet return spring 8a, park pawl 9a and parking ratchet wheel 12a, described cam 7a can move axially, its be pressed in ratchet return spring 8a left side extension above, described ratchet return spring 8a is arranged on the top of park pawl 9a front end, below its left side extension, be pressed on park pawl 9a, described park pawl 9a is rotatably installed on mission case by detent pin 10a, its front end has the boss 9a1 stretching out downwards, described parking ratchet wheel 12a excircle is provided with the restraining groove 12a1 matching with the boss 9a1 on park pawl 9a, described cam 7a moves axially and drives ratchet return spring 8a to move up and down, ratchet return spring 8a drives again park pawl 9a to move up and down, make its boss 9a1 income or exit the restraining groove 12a1 on parking ratchet wheel 12a, described parking ratchet wheel 12a is installed on differential casing 11a.Because parking ratchet wheel 12a is installed on differential casing 11a, like this, under the severe condition of operating mode, even if parking ratchet wheel 12a is stressed excessive, also can not depart from from differential casing 11a, also after can not causing the boss 9a1 of park pawl 9a front end to snap in the restraining groove 12a1 on parking ratchet wheel 12a, get loose, parking was lost efficacy.Thereby reliability is higher.
Described parking ratchet wheel 12a adopts bolt to be installed on differential casing 11a.Such connection is reliable.
Shown in Fig. 3 and Fig. 4, the end face of described parking ratchet wheel 12a is provided with at least two spacing pin 12a2; The end face of described differential casing 11a is provided with the spacing hole 11a1 that the location pin 12a2 that is provided with parking ratchet wheel 12a matches; Parking ratchet wheel 12a is connected with spacing hole 11a1 by location pin 12a2 with differential casing 11a.Like this, when under the more severe condition of operating mode, spacing pin 12a2 and spacing hole 11a1 that this is connected can offset a part of parking peripheral force.The shearing force that larger weakening bolt is subject to, guarantees that parking ratchet wheel 12a and differential casing 11a link together reliably, can not cause parking because of trackslipping of parking ratchet wheel 12a and lose efficacy.And parking ratchet wheel 12a is arranged on differential casing, also effectively utilize space, the axial dimension of speed changer has reduced greatly, and the ability of speed changer coupling car load has also obtained expanding greatly.
Working principle of the present utility model is as follows:
This automotive transmission parking system adopts electronics automatic parking, and it is upper that parking ratchet wheel 12a is arranged in differential casing 11a, is connected with differential casing 11a by bolt and location pin 12a2 thereof.Parking actuator adopts motor 1a to drive, the high speed of motor 1a output is by worm gear 3a and worm screw 2a deceleration that can self-locking, process gear 4a and tooth bar 5a are converted into rotatablely moving of worm gear 3a the axial motion of tooth bar 5a again, thereby promote park pawl 9a, make, in the restraining groove 12a1 of its boss 9a1 income parking ratchet wheel 12a, to realize parking.On the contrary, when motor 1a reversion, park pawl 9a can be along moving in the other direction, and boss 9a1 exits the restraining groove 12a1 of parking ratchet wheel 12a, and parking is removed.
